Bear collection part of senior project

A Columbus North High School student is looking for new or gently-used stuffed animals that Bartholomew County Sheriff deputies may hand out to children during critical incidents.

North Senior Cole Hopkins is being mentored by Sgt. Andrew Whipker in the senior project. Collection bins have been placed at businesses around the community and in the lobby of the Bartholomew County Jail.

From 11 a.m. to 1 p.m. Saturday, Hopkins and Whipker will be stationed in the north lot of the sheriff’s department, weather permitting, to accept drive-thru donations for the project.
